Full Description
This straightforward course based on the idea of a limit is intended for students who have acquired a working knowledge of the calculus and are ready for a more systematic treatment which also brings in other limiting processes, such as the summation of infinite series and the expansion of trigonometric functions as power series. Particular attention is given to clarity of exposition and the logical development of the subject matter. A large number of examples is included, with hints for the solution of many of them.
Contents
Preface; 1. Numbers; 2. Sequences; 3. Continuous functions; 4. The differential calculus; 5. Infinite series; 6. The special functions of analysis; 7. The integral calculus; 8. Functions of several variables; Notes on the exercises; Index.
